Transaction 988cf3e00434e1f508f766b789e4ac760a098a5bf61101eba54d9187936da911
1 Input
1 Output
-
988cf3e00434e1f508f766b789e4ac760a098a5bf61101eba54d9187936da911:0
- value
- 733166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 618a77134503d94f6a0e2b76064e0b6d5c625585 OP_EQUAL
- address
- 3AamLsryJGjZh4JYbq29L9mwPmK1fFC5SX